Key ingredients and how they support barrier repair

  • Bifidus prebiotic: included at 10% to support the skin’s ecosystem and help the barrier function.
  • Hyaluronic acid: used to support hydration so skin looks and feels more comfortable.
  • Triple ceramide complex: focuses on replenishing key barrier lipids. Ceramides are naturally present in the skin barrier and are described as crucial for maintaining healthy hydration and protection.

Overall, the ingredient stack is geared toward barrier repair plus hydration, which is why it tends to appeal to shoppers who feel like their skin needs more “support” than a purely cosmetic moisturizer.
